How will you make an impact?
The Quality Supervisor is responsible for leading and developing Quality Inspectors while ensuring internal and external customer requirements are consistently met. This role drives quality performance through effective team leadership, training, process compliance, and continuous improvement initiatives that support operational excellence.
What will you do?
Supervise daily activities of Quality Inspectors and other assigned personnel.
Recruit, train, coach, and develop Quality team members.
Monitor team performance and provide ongoing feedback, development, and performance management.
Develop and maintain training programs to ensure employees are qualified to customer and company requirements.
Coordinate staffing and scheduling to meet production and quality objectives.
Train and qualify inspectors to customer-specific quality standards and inspection requirements.
Monitor quality and productivity metrics and drive continuous improvement initiatives.
Provide technical support and guidance on inspection-related issues.
Support 5S and workplace organization initiatives.
Promote a culture of quality, accountability, teamwork, and employee engagement.
Ensure compliance with customer requirements, company procedures, and all safety, health, security, and operational standards.

Mid Level Shift Supervisor Jobs: Frequently Asked Questions
How do I get a mid level shift supervisor job?
Position yourself by highlighting concrete ownership: shifts you ran independently, scheduling or staffing decisions you made, and measurable outcomes like reduced turnover or improved throughput. Applications that show you've moved beyond following procedures to shaping them, and that demonstrate you've mentored or corrected team members, land mid level roles. Lead with impact, not just tenure.

How do I move up to a mid level shift supervisor role?
Getting to mid level means building a record of expanding responsibility over your first few years, moving from executing tasks to owning outcomes. That shift happens when you take on scheduling, handle team conflicts independently, drive measurable improvements in quality or efficiency, and earn trust to run a full shift without a senior supervisor present. Consistent, documented impact is what makes the case.
